In my old singer, I'm using a waxed linen shoe thread with Singer leather needles. Its about the same thickness as button thread. Its the biggest stuff I can get to work with mine. Is the thread seperating or snapping as it passes through the eye?

if you put thread through the eye hold thread tight and it slides up n down easy without getting snaged then it will sew in ya machine always use thinner thread in the bottom bobbin
